HMS Raleigh was commissioned on 9 January 1940 as a training establishment for Ordinary Seamen following the Military Training Act which required that all males aged 20 and 21 years old be called up for six months full-time military training, and then transferred to the reserve. It is spread over several square miles and has damage control simulators and fire-fighting training facilities, as well as a permanently moored training ship, the former HMS Brecon. HMS Raleigh Medical Centre provides primary care and occupational health to Royal Navy Phase 1 recruits and the unit's permanent members of staff. At HMS Raleigh, the passing out parade is a major career milestone marking the point when a cadet officially earns their place in the Royal Navy, after ten weeks of Basic Training, and before the start of role specific Professional Training.
